Ecclestone: Vettel needs to go where the best car is

Bernie Ecclestone is a big Sebastian Vettel fan Switching to a team with the best car would be the way for Sebastian Vettel to re-ignite his Formula 1 career, according to Formula 1 supremo Bernie Ecclestone. After winning four consecutive F1 world championships, the German has stumbled in 2014. And it's not just Red Bull's fault, as Vettel has struggled even to keep up with his new teammate Daniel Ricciardo, who has stunned the entire world of Formula 1 with his form. But Formula 1 chief executive Ecclestone, famously close to Vettel, thinks that while the 26-year-old has lost none of his talent, he must be casting his eyes around for a better car.
